2 I Place the wheel in the frame so that the metal
surfaces of the rear dropouts t between the counter
plates (inside) and support plates (outside).
1 I Install the thru axle and ttings on the thru-axle
compatible wheel.
3 I Adjust the chain tension and tighten the thru axle
to a torque of 10Nm. The thru axle head slots into
the dedicated recess.
4 I Ensure the adjustment screws rest against the
assembled plates by turning the adjustment rollers
on each side. This will prevent the wheel sliding
forward under intense pressure.
INSTALLING THE THRU AXLE FITTINGS
CAUTION : the plates must rest on the metal
surfaces, not on any carbon part as this could
sustain damage.
Excessive tightening of the axle (torque
above 10Nm) can cause permanent damage
or deformation of the ttings, and affect the
efficiency of the wheel locking system.
